I have a 2017 Rebel with air ride. I started noticing some softness in the rear end, especially after driving down some rough road for a while. There are a lot of times where expansion joints and large cracks in the road (I'm in Illinois, so all roads are crap) will cause the back end to jump to the right. Anyway I dropped the rear axle today ànd disconnected both rear shocks. The driver's side was pretty weak. I could pretty easily compress with much effort. The passenger side was WAY harder to compress. To the point where I contemplated getting the ratchet straps out to recompress and bolt back up.
So, I started looking for replacement shocks and I cannot find anything except the $230 Bilstein OEM Mopar shocks. Has anyone tried any other shocks, or does anyone know if anyone makes rear shocks for the air ride equiped rebels?
Please don't just suggest to replace the air ride. I like it and it works perfectly. I just want to replace the shocks since I have 62K+ miles and the roads near me are horrible.
